Riepilogo:This study develops a methodology for approaching homilies that draws on a broader understanding of audience as both the physical audience and the readership of sermons. It then offers a case study on the Syriac preacher Jacob of Serguh whose metrical homilies form one of the largest sermon collections in any language from late antiquity
Descrizione del documento:Revised version of the doctoral dissertation submitted to Princeton Theological Seminary in Spring 2016
